HIV-1 infection in rural Africa: is there a difference in median time to AIDS and survival compared with that in industrialized countries?

Survival with HIV-1 infection is similar in Africa to industrialized countries before the use of antiretroviral therapy; when they do die, many of those in Africa are severely immunosuppressed and most have clinical features of AIDS.
